The word I hear is drivers of factory backed Mazda pro teams are no longer allowed to compete against Mazda products in another series/class. So guys like Pobst that drive in more than one series now have to drive only in a Mazda or pick a series/class that Mazda does not have a car in.

For instance he can drive a Porsche in World Challenge GT because there are no Mazda's in GT. In GrandAm GT now you have SpeedSource in there with a Mazda so the Porsche is not an option anymore.
Smart move, you don't want your best WC TC driver beating your other teams in another series.

Kind of like the Cup boys, you don't see Dale Jr running a Ford in Busch, always better for business to keep your top talent in your cars.

No doubt he can help put SpeedSource on top.

Talking with David Haskell at seveonstock, they are making about 260-265hp in the 2 rotor. Remember it's on higher octane fuel than the street for more agressive tuning. The 3 rotor makes around 420 hp or so. They could have made more power though but opted to have more average power. Their engine makes less peak power than the Courage does and has a lower redline. They have more average power (torque) within their powerband than the Courage does due to longer intake runners.

Nope that's flywheel. At the wheels they do somewhere around 229-233 or so. They do not have ceramic seals or anything special done to the engines. People keep thinking there must be something special about their engines but there isn't. They are effectively no different from what you get in an RX-8. The engine is just better than most people give it credit for.
